“The Pursuit of Radiance” (November 14, 2021) Worship Service
As the darkest days of the year arrive, lights appear everywhere: ropes of lights outline tall buildings, colorful Christmas lights brighten windows and trees, candles are lit reverently in Hanukkah menorahs, Kwansa kinaras and winter solstice rituals. We humans instinctively crave and seek out light when days are dark. This is true, metaphorically, in our personal lives as well. When our days are dark and despair fills our lives, we crave the light of hope, insight and love. The sermon will explore light as a symbol of the human spirit, and how we can bring more light into our lives.
